Felbi can be wet or dry felted. It can also be used in machine embellishing. For feltmakers, Felbi needle felt eliminates the need to "layout", allowing you to spend more time on your design. It can be wet felted in the same way as you would felt wooltops(felting wool). Felbi gives a smooth, even finish when felted. It easily integrates other fabrics, silks and yarns through processes feltmakers call 'nuno felting' or 'laminating'.

Dry Felting involves using felting needles manually or with a sewing machine embellisher that has felting needles fitted to it.
Felbi is a great product for creating felt 'yardage' for garment construction and a life saver when having to teach felting to school students in a 50 minute session!.
The density of the Felbi needle felt does vary somewhat (an industrial limitation) but it is approximately 75 gsm (grams per square metre).
Two sizes are available: 'Planks' approx 35 cm by 200 cm and 'Logs' 150 cm by 200cm. The sizes are approximate due to the potential drafting (stretching) and settling of the Felbi.
Felbi does need to be felted. It does not have enough structural integrity in its original state to use as a finished textile. |
